Tour to the seven lakes in Ridanna Valley

This extensive and quite challenging mountain tour takes between eight and nine hours. Prerequisites are good general health, prior mountain experience and good weather. This hike leads you to the Stubai Alps and, nomen est omen, past seven lakes. The trail starts at the mining museum in Masseria/Maiern in Val Ridanna. Head towards Moarbergalm and, afterwards, towards Grohmannhütte. Here, follow the signs indicating the tour of the 7 lakes (“7 laghi/7 Seen”).
To the Aglsbodenalm in Ridanna Valley

If you are looking for a more leisurely hike, we recommend you this hike leading to the mountain hut at the end of Ridanna Valley. This hike takes about one to two hours. Starting point is Masseria/Maiern, about five minutes by car from our hotel in Ridanna Valley. Follow the small road to the Gsennen farm and the signs towards "Aglsbodenalm". The trail is wide and not very steep, leading across woods an partly over meadows. The lodge is situated at 1,720 metres and open in summer. Tip: stop for a refreshment.
